So far 3 fish have found their way into the sump via the overflow and have all been rescued. I have to go get some block filter foam and cover the overflows for a couple weeks until they get big enough!!
 
Added the block foam over the overflow slots. The same fish keeps making his way into the sump, one of the makokolas I think!! I've found him there 3 times and the owner has twice. No more hopefully. Test the water, Ammonia 0 Nitrite 0 Nitrate 20 Alkalinity 3.8, so have to work on raising that. Right now there's only 5 lbs of crushed coral in the sump, I got a bigger bag for the other 10 lbs and I'm going to move the pump in the sump to another area and position the CC for better flow-through, hopefully that will bring it up. Shooting for 8.0.

The fish are very lively and friendly, especially the Saulosi, the race right to where you are and follow you around, and the little ones come up to see what all the fuss is about. I'm going to have a fun time counting them next time I have a chance to see if there have been any losses, but other than the Yellow Labs getting picked on a bit (and they don't seem any worse) everyone looks fine.

Tank is doing well, time to get a pleco though, starting to get some algae growth on the rocks and glass - brown diatom.

There have been a couple fish death, mainly the female Saulois that are holding. I guess I need to learn how to strip them. There are about 4 fry living in the sump along with the 15lb of crushed coral!!

The owner does a pretty good job of doing weekly 50% PWCs. After about 2 months with fish in the tank, Nitrates are around 10-15.
